The 1-1 Botola 1 draw between FUS Rabat and Kawkab AC Marrakech delivered a balanced contest with late momentum shifts. Marrakech struck first in the second half, at 01:28:59, and Rabat recovered to level at 01:36:35. The result highlights a tight tactical duel where key moments in the second period dictated the outcome.
Attacking intent showed through a higher volume of set-piece activity for Marrakech, who earned four corner kicks to Rabat’s one. The away goal came from a productive second-half sequence, while Rabat’s equaliser arrived soon after, illustrating their capacity to respond quickly to adverse moments. The disparity in corners suggests Marrakech tested Rabat more aggressively from wide positions.
Defensively, both teams maintained discipline and structure, with Rabat committing 15 fouls to Marrakech’s 13 and collecting a single yellow card compared with Marrakech’s zero. There were no red cards, underscoring a relatively clean and controlled approach from both sides. The offside counts—Marrakech 2 to Rabat 1—point to Marrakech’s continued willingness to stretch the defence, even when conceding.
From a tactical standpoint, Marrakech’s set-piece activity indicates they sought to leverage width and crosses as a route to goal, while Rabat relied more on compact defending and rapid transitions to generate their equaliser. The equaliser demonstrates Rabat’s ability to capitalize on a moment of opportunity following Marrakech’s pressure, sealing a draw rather than allowing a late winner. The data imply Marrakech pressed effectively after halftime, while Rabat’s response demonstrated resilience and a swift, coordinated reassertion of shape.
